Output 6f9261977818a08feaa177feb6b9175b234ea207f4c91bed128d14bf2921fe89:1

value
4590092602
script pubkey
OP_0 OP_PUSHBYTES_20 30911fd29a84b66bfba35b472061c0f3fde0c026
address
tb1qxzg3l556sjmxh7artdrjqcwq7077pspxdxm94u
transaction
6f9261977818a08feaa177feb6b9175b234ea207f4c91bed128d14bf2921fe89